Dimension Control Technician
An aerospace client is looking for a Dimension Control Technician to maintain a clean and organized workshop environment, perform maintenance of critical assembly tooling fixtures as well as performing tooling cycles, reworks and revisions.
Location: Palmdale, CA 93550 (On-site)
Position: Dimension Control Technician
Pay Rate: $20.64/hr. – $24.12/hr. on W2 (Negotiable-DOE)
Duration: 6 months or longer
Schedule: 4×10 (M-Th)
Shift: Must be willing to work Any Shift, 1st and 2nd shift are Monday through Thursday. 1st is 5:00am-3:50pm and 2nd is 4:12pm 2:42am.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Maintain a clean and organized workshop environment, perform maintenance of critical assembly tooling fixtures as well as performing tooling cycles, reworks and revisions.
- Machine shop environment, Close knit team culture.
- Will start day by performing shop 5s, will then be assigned work by shop leads, candidate will perform/support assignment maintenance/repair/inspection and housekeeping
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
- US Citizenship is required.
- High School Diploma or equivalent
- This is an Entry Level position.
- Assembly tooling
- Highly organization, Good Communication, self-starter, problem solver, positive attitude, safety minded.
- Ability to lift 50lbs.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
- An understanding of basic mechanics and experience in the use of various hand tools.
- Top 3-5 skills/technologies: Basic hand tools, Microsoft office suite, Jig and fixture/ Tool building experience, laser tracker experience, Machine shop experience, Verisurf, Mastercam. – preferred
